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Skinner Street was 62.5 per 1,000 residents, which is 37.9% lower than the Elmton-with-Creswell average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Skinner Street has the 9th lowest crime rate of 20 local areas in Elmton-with-Creswell and the 120th lowest crime rate of 249 local areas in Bolsover .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 41.7 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 50.5%.
